Research impact was assessed based on qualitative impact studies that detailed approach to impact. In the approach to impact section of an impact study, institutions described the strategies implemented by the institution, its colleges, faculties, groups, departments and/or centres that facilitated the impact described in the impact section of the submission.

The charts show the number of assessed UoAs and the distribution of ratings for approach to impact by two-digit Fields of Research (FoR), interdisciplinary, and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ander research.

The codes with the largest number of high rated UoAs were 07 Agricultural and Veterinary Sciences (13), 09 Engineering (12), 12 Built Environment and Design (11), and 11 Biomedical and Clinical Sciences (11).

The codes with the highest percentage of high rated UoAs for approach to impact were 12 Built Environment and Design (58 per cent) and 07 Agricultural, Veterinary Sciences (57 per cent) and 10 Technology (45 per cent).

FoRs 03 Chemical Sciences, 13 Education and 16 Studies in Human Society had the highest number of Low ratings (12). FoR 05 Environmental Sciences had the most Medium ratings (23) and FoR 07 Agricultural and Veterinary Sciences had the most High ratings (13).
